The Columbus, Ohio office of international design firm NBBJ is designing the new headquarters for the Housing Bank For Trade and Finance (HBTF), the largest bank branch network in Jordan. Located in the Schmeisani section of Amman, the new HBTF headquarters will feature a modern, iconic design helping to re-shape the city’s evolving skyline. It will also be among a handful of buildings in Amman created under the current sustainable design guidelines. Once completed, the new facility will provide employees with a state-of-the-art work environment to deliver even better service to customers.
The new 76,000 sqm headquarters will accommodate up to 1,200 employees and will address the bank’s need for flexibility, operational efficiency and consolidation. The design will feature an intelligent façade with flexible interior systems that allows the bank to accommodate industry and technological advancements without undergoing intensive renovations.
Plans also include sustainable elements such as special landscaping that conserves water and provides shade from the sun for the site. The 7-story headquarters includes an office tower, new prototype for future retail branch locations and below-grade parking facilities.
